Ordinals
beta
Sat 916853023476171
decimal
183370.3023476171
degree
0°183370′1930″3023476171‴
percentile
43.65966783260522%
name
hiwqpngxhba
cycle
0
epoch
0
period
90
block
183370
offset
3023476171
timestamp
2012-06-07 03:50:24 UTC
rarity
common
prev
next